Calibration of contractors impact wrenches is performed in the field using our own Skidmore-Owens calibration equipment. Our laboratory maintains the necessary calibration equipment to calibrate contractors torque wrenches and skidmores.

 

Surface flaw detections of Ferro-magnetic materials are performed using penetrants and developers. Applications can be performed in our laboratory or in the field as required. Oil base and or water base penetrants are used in accordance with clients specific requirements. Applications include: searching for flaw detection in existing structure analysis, parts for use in the aircraft industry, and military procurement contracts. Elemental Analysis of metals is performed in our own facility. Computerized state-of-theart testing equipment maintains our leadership for accuracy in testing and reporting of test results. With the use of our HGA furnace, many test results of elements can be reported in parts per billion (PPB). Additional equipment capabilities include wear metal analysis in oils, paint, waste water, pharmaceutical, industrial, forensic and environmental testing.

Wet and dry method technologies are used by our Non-Destructive Testing technicians for in-house inspection for discontinuities and flaw detection of smaller size part (as shown). Larder parts and structural members, including welds, are tested using portable (powered) equipment and yokes in the field. Our testing is performed in compliance with AWS, ASME, and ASNT codes as may be required.

 

Testing is performed at either the fabrication shop, construction site or our testing facility by verified non-destructive testing technicians for the inspection of full-penetration and butt welds. ITL has numerous types of laboratory and field test equipment so as to test under the most difficult field situations and limited accessibility conditions. We maintain an inventory of special designed transducers which can assist in performing inspections previously thought impractical. Portable Ultrasonic Thickness Detectors enable us to inspect the wall thickness of active steam pipes, various metals, and report results on a digital readout to an accuracy of .001 inch.
